Facility Coordinator Job Description Summary
The Facilities Coordinator provides assistance to the facility management team to ensure successful service delivery of the client facility needs. Directly supports the facility management team with on-going facility and team related responsibilities.
Job Description 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S AND RESPONSIBILITIES
• Provide general facility management services, including continuous monitoring of office/facility
• Address client inquiries and concerns ensuring timely and quality issue resolution and service delivery
• Assist in purchase order creation, monitoring approval streams, and work scheduling
• Respond to all facility inquiries and complaints, assess problems, and take the necessary corrective action, including client communication
• Remain knowledgeable regarding all operational aspects of building systems
• Coordinate with outside contractors for the service and repairs of equipment
• Follow protocol for effective building-specific maintenance and safety procedures
• Maintain on-going communication with contractors, client, and team
• Assist with site inspection within the assigned building portfolio
• Create work orders and assign work orders to the engineering staff, subcontractors, and vendors
• Report on open and closed work orders and check the status of open work orders with the assigned party
• Request, review, and submit work orders, bids, and proposals from vendors
• Verify final invoice pricing and process payments in a timely manner
• Assist in the monitoring and assessment of vendor performance
• Train vendors on work order and billing procedures
• Manage complex work orders such as environmental issues and disaster recovery
• Manage service and performance of vendors and landlords for timely completion of jobs
• Create and record appropriate written communication between all parties
• Schedule and document maintenance and repairs on building equipment
• Communicate frequently with client, landlords, and vendors to resolve issues and provide project status updates
• Provide process and procedures training and direction to new associates
• Coordinate special events in support of client
• Assist with measuring and reporting key performance indicators against service level agreements KEY COMPETENCIES
